Proyecto

General

Perfil

Tipo de metadato UserLink

Información

Autor Karen Gomez Quiroz
Sitio Web
Repositorio source:UserLinkMetadata/trunk/src
Código fuente http://svn-community.adapting.com:8080/svn/Community/Plugins/UserLinkMetadata/trunk/
Versión Actual v1.0
Compatible con Abox 2.4.1-2.5.3-2.5.5

Resumen

Este tipo de metadato permite seleccionar un usuario como un valor de un metadato de un usuario. Cuando se define el metadato, se puede seleccionar el tipo de usuario y un usuario por defecto como valor del metadato. Este plugin es interesante cuando se quiere relacionar directamente un contenido con un contenido, por ejemplo para relacionar una carpeta con una usuario en concreto.

Notas de instalación

Descargue el código fuente del plugin y compílelo usando Visual Studio 2010. Luego dependiendo si lo va a integrar en una instalación de Abox o en un proyecto de extensión de Abox sigua las siguientes instrucciones.

En una instalación de Abox

Copiar en la dll que genera el proyecto, en principio se debe llamar Adapting.UserLink.dll, en la carpeta /bin del sitio web donde esta Abox. Luego copiar la vista UserLinkField.ascx en la carpeta Fields que se encuentra en Areas/Network/Views/

En el JavaScript PopupLib.js ubicado en .../Content/JavaScript se realizaron cambios en la Función OKFunction:

function OKFunction(containername, resulttype, scriptOnClose) {
    var ids = "";
    var returnLabel;
    if (resulttype.toLowerCase() == 'count') {
        returnLabel = 0;
    } else {
        returnLabel = "";
    }
    var obj = $("#" + containername + "-picker-target-list > .row");
       if (obj.length == 0) {    
            //Fixme:: Esto hay q ponerlo porq Abox no tiene en cuenta cualquier nombre para el popup.
            obj = $("#hUsers-picker-target-list > .row");
        }

    var ids = "";
h3. En un proyecto de extensión de Abox.

Incluya el proyecto en su proyecto para extender Abox, añada una referencia en Adapting.Web al proyecto que acaba de incluir. Luego copiar la vista UserLinkField.ascx en la carpeta Fields que se encuentra en Areas/Network/Views/ en el proyecto Adapting.Web

Guía de uso

Historico

05/09/2011 Integrado en Abox desde la versión 2.5

Volver al inicio
Agregar imagen desde el portapapeles (Tamaño máximo: 10 MB)